简介:
随着云计算和开源技术的不断发展,越来越多的企业和个人开始使用开源服务器来搭建自己的网站、应用或服务。本文将介绍如何在阿里云上部署开源服务器,并提供一些常见的开源服务器选择以及部署流程的详细说明。
1. 选择适合的开源服务器
首先,我们需要选择适合的开源服务器来满足我们的需求。以下是一些常用的开源服务器:
-
Apache HTTP Server:是一款广泛使用的Web服务器软件,适用于搭建动态网站和静态网站。
-
Nginx:是一款高性能的反向代理服务器和负载均衡器,适用于高并发和高性能的应用场景。
-
WordPress:是一款流行的开源内容管理系统,适用于搭建个人博客和企业网站。
-
Tomcat:是一款常用的Java Web服务器,适用于Java应用的部署和运行。
2. 部署过程
接下来,我们将详细介绍如何在阿里云上部署开源服务器。以Apache HTTP Server为例,以下是部署流程:
-
登录阿里云控制台,选择ECS(弹性计算服务)。
-
创建一台云服务器实例,并选择合适的地域和实例规格。
-
安装操作系统,可以选择Linux系统镜像,如CentOS、Ubuntu等。
-
连接到云服务器实例,可以使用SSH客户端工具进行连接。
-
在云服务器实例中安装Apache HTTP Server,并配置好相关参数。
-
启动Apache HTTP Server,并验证是否成功运行。
-
如果需要,还可以进行其他配置,如设置域名解析、配置防火墙等。
3. 其他开源服务器的选择和部署
除了Apache HTTPServer外,还有许多其他的开源服务器可供选择。例如,对于数据库服务器,我们可以选择MySQL、PostgreSQL等;对于消息队列,可以选择RabbitMQ、Kafka等。具体的部署流程可以根据不同的开源服务器进行调整和优化。
总结:
通过本文的介绍,相信您已经了解了如何在阿里云上部署开源服务器的基本步骤。无论您是想搭建个人博客还是企业网站,选择合适的开源服务器并正确地进行部署都是非常重要的。希望本文对您有所帮助!